I recently began making homemade dog food for my two chihuahuas, and I am following recipes online and creating diversity in the meals, but I am concerned about them getting enough nutrients and vitamins. One of the two dogs has congestive heart failure and is a little overweight, is the foods that I made for the other dog ok for her to eat as well? The dog with heart failure takes medicine that our vet subscribed, but I read online that giving flaxseed oil, and certian vitamins like l-carnitine are good for her heart, is it ok to combine those in the recipe and allow the other dog to consume them as well or should I only give these to the dog with heart disease? I also would like to know what vitamins and how much should I give to the dogs daily?

I don't know exactly what you are preparing for your dogs, but I suggest you read my answer to "Opinions of Raw Feeding" from October 12. For a dog with congestive heart failure, I would include an ounce of raw beef heart daily, CoQ10,and the chinese herb Jiao gu lan.Hawthorne extract may also help.
